How Many Gpm For A Shower Head. Also known as “flow rate,” gpm is a measure of how much water flows out of your shower head each minute. In the united states, the maximum allowable flow rate for shower heads is typically 2.5 gpm. This is the maximum amount of water that flows out of the shower head each minute. When it comes to shower heads, you'll typically find 2.5 gpm, 2.0 gpm, 1.8 gpm and 1.5 gpm. Gpm means gallons per minute.
